NEW DELHI: Sunrisers Hyderabad have signed Gerald Coetzee as a replacement for David Payne for the remainder of IPL 2026. SRH confirmed the development in an official media advisory on Saturday, with Payne ruled out due to an ankle injury. The left-arm pacer played two matches this season and picked up two wickets before being sidelined.“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) have signed Gerald Coetzee as a replacement for David Payne for the remainder of TATA Indian Premier League (IPL) 2026. Payne – who played 2 games for SRH in the ongoing IPL season and picked 2 wickets from the same – is ruled out of the remainder of the season due to an ankle injury,” the league said in a statement.Coetzee, a right-arm fast bowler, brings valuable international experience, having represented South Africa national cricket team across formats. The 24-year-old has featured in four Tests, 14 ODIs and 18 T20Is, taking a combined 67 wickets.He had gone unsold in this year’s auction but has prior IPL experience with Mumbai Indians and Gujarat Titans, claiming 15 wickets in 14 matches.The 25-year-old was part of South Africa’s squad for the T20 World Cup but did not get a game. After the tournament, he played all five T20Is against New Zealand. He will join SRH for INR 2 crore.Meanwhile, SRH have also been boosted by the return of captain Pat Cummins, who linked up with the squad on April 17 and is expected to feature in their April 25 clash against Rajasthan Royals. Currently placed fifth on the table, SRH are set to face Chennai Super Kings on April 18.Coetzee, known for his pace and aggressive style, adds further strength to SRH’s bowling unit as they push for a strong finish to the season.
